Construction Staking

Surveys used during construction to set stakes (markers) that provide horizontal and vertical information on where to build structures such as buildings, curb, utility lines, signs, walls and any other important items to be constructed. The surveys are used to ensure that all structures and other items are built in the correct locations.

Building Pad Certification Survey

A Survey performed one the dirt pad is constructed to verify that the building
pad is in the correct horizontal and vertical location.

Form Certification Survey

A survey performed  when the form of a particular structure (curb, building slab, or other structure) is in place, yet prior to the actual construction of said structure.

Building Height Certification Surveys

A survey performed near the end of the construction of a building in order to verify the height is under the height limit required by local ordinances.

As-Built Surveys

A survey performed after construction to certify that all improvement were built according to the approved plans.

Boundary & Topographic Surveys

Perform a field survey to establish boundary and property lines and show all
improvements including buildings, other permanent structures, utilities, curb,
sidewalk, concrete, driveways, trees, and any other items of importance.  

Monument Perpetuation Surveys

Surveys to locate survey monuments prior to construction and then replace the survey monuments after construction.
